Playa Bowls restaurant opens on Franklin Street in convenient location for students


A new acai shop, Playa Bowls, opened on Aug. 11 at 104 E. Franklin St., next to Starbucks on the corner of Franklin Street and Columbia Street in downtown Chapel Hill. Playa Bowls is a restaurant chain with over 200 storefronts across 22 states. The business began in 2014 in Belmar, NJ when two surfers opened up an acai stand outside a pizza shop. (Daily Tar Heel)
